Colour Image Science takes an interdisciplinary approach, combining aspects of human vision with colour image capture, processing and reproduction:
- Colour Vision - How we see and remember colours
- Multispectral Imaging - Capturing and storing images in more than 3 channels
- Image Processing - Correcting image colours and accessing databasess
- Gamut Mapping - How to render colours in cross-media image reproduction
- Image Quality - Metrics and methods for assessing images
Colour Image Science will appeal to a wide readership, including scientists and engineers involved in the research and development of colour imaging products. It will also be a valuable reference text for post-graduate students in computer science, digital imaging and multimedia programmes.
